STEP 3 -
LEARN THE KEYPAD & DISPLAY
Cuddeback is programmed by using a 2 line
LCD display and 5 keys. (
Figure 9
).
The KEY is used to enable or disable the
camera and to view information. The KEY
is used to set the date, time, delay and other
settings. The
KEY &
KEY are used to
change settings or view information.
KEY
is a general purpose key used for various tasks.

Delay
01 min
1) Camera Delay. After taking a picture, the camera will wait this amount of time
before arming itself for the next picture.
a) If [Camera Delay] is not displayed on the
LCD, press
numerous times until
[Camera Delay] is displayed (
figure 11
).
b) Press
or
to change the setting.
c) The range is 1 minute to 60 minutes.
